When building a **marketplace** (multi-vendor platform like Amazon, Etsy, or Urban Company) in India, standard payment gateways won't cut it. You need a solution that supports **split payments** (automatically dividing the customer's payment between multiple sellers and taking your platform commission) and handles vendor onboarding seamlessly. The top payment gateways for a multi-vendor marketplace in India feature specialized marketplace infrastructure: --- ## 1. Razorpay (Razorpay Route) Razorpay is arguably the most popular and developer-friendly payment gateway for marketplaces in India. * **Marketplace Tool:** **Razorpay Route** * **How it Works:** It lets you accept money from a buyer, split the funds dynamically among multiple vendors, deduct your platform commission, and handle automated payouts/refunds. * **Key Features:** * Full control over nodal account holdings. * * Excellent documentation and developer tools. * Top-tier success rates for UPI, Credit/Debit cards, Net Banking, and Pay Later options. * **Best For:** Startups and scaling marketplaces that want a robust, API-first ecosystem. ## 2. Cashfree Payments (Cashfree Marketplace) Cashfree is highly competitive, especially known for its low transaction costs and instant payout features. * **Marketplace Tool:** **Cashfree Marketplace** * **How it Works:** Automates vendor onboarding, splits payments instantly at checkout, and routes commissions directly to your platform account. * **Key Features:** * **Instant Payouts:** Sellers can get their split instantly (even on bank holidays) via IMPS/UPI instead of waiting for standard settlement cycles ($T+2$). * * Highly aggressive pricing structures. * Strong automated refund handling across multi-vendor checkouts. * **Best For:** Platforms looking for the fastest seller payouts and high cost-efficiency. ## 3. Stripe India (Stripe Connect) Stripe is the gold standard globally for complex multi-vendor marketplaces, though its setup in India requires strict adherence to local RBI guidelines. * **Marketplace Tool:** **Stripe Connect** * **How it Works:** Manages the entire payment flow, handles global-to-local compliance, and allows deep customization over how money moves between buyers, the platform, and sellers. * **Key Features:** * Incredibly sophisticated routing, logic, and escrow-like holdings. * * AI-powered fraud detection (Stripe Radar). * Excellent if your marketplace plans to cater to international buyers. * **Best For:** Enterprise-level or tech-heavy marketplaces requiring advanced custom payment flows or cross-border capabilities. ## 4. PayU India (PayU Split) PayU is an enterprise-grade player that powers some of India's largest e-commerce websites. * **Marketplace Tool:** **PayU Split** * **How it Works:** Allows complex split rules (percentage or fixed amounts) to distribute funds to an unlimited number of vendors seamlessly. * **Key Features:** * Exceptional success rates due to direct integrations with major Indian banks. * * Supports custom checkout experiences. * Deep data analytics dashboard for multi-vendor reconciliation. * **Best For:** Established or high-volume marketplaces looking for enterprise reliability. --- ### Comparison Summary | Gateway Tool | Best Feature | Pricing (Approx) | Ideal Use Case | |:--- |:--- |:--- |:--- | | **Razorpay Route** | Seamless API Integration & Developer Tools | ~2% per transaction | General Multi-vendor Startups & D2C | | **Cashfree Marketplace** | Instant Vendor Payouts ($24 \times 7$) | ~1.6% - 2% per transaction | High-frequency, low-margin platforms | | **Stripe Connect** | Complex Custom Routings & Global Reach | ~2% - 3%+ (Higher for international) | Tech-heavy platforms, Global buyers | | **PayU Split** | Deep Bank Integrations & High Success Rates | ~2% per transaction | Enterprise & Large-scale Marketplaces | ### Key Considerations Before Choosing: 1. **RBI Guidelines:** Ensure the gateway you pick handles the strict RBI compliance rules regarding automated split payments and nodal accounts correctly. 2. **Onboarding Compliance:** Look closely at how each gateway handles KYC for your vendors (whether they integrate a digital KYC flow into your platform or handle it externally). Marketplaces require specialized infrastructure to automatically split a single customer checkout payment among multiple sellers, deduct platform commissions, and manage escrow payouts legally. Top Marketplace Payment Gateways Compared | Payment Gateway | Best For | Core Marketplace Feature | Standard Fee | Settlement Time | |---|---|---|---|---| | **Cashfree Payments** | High-volume marketplaces & instant vendor payouts | Marketplace Split API (Vendor Payouts) | From 1.95% | Instant / T+1 days | | **Razorpay** | Developer-friendly tech stacks & SaaS marketplaces | Razorpay Route (Split & Escrow) | ~2.00% | T+2 to T+3 days | | **** | Scaled enterprise marketplaces | PayU Multiplex (Custom settlements) | ~2.00% | T+2 days | Detailed Breakdown of the Top Providers - **Cashfree Payments**: This is widely considered the top choice specifically optimized for Indian multi-vendor marketplaces. - **Marketplace Capabilities**: Its dynamic **Vendor Split feature** automatically divides a single customer cart value among multiple sellers in real-time. - **Payout Speed**: It offers instant bank account settlements (even on bank holidays), helping you keep marketplace sellers happy with rapid liquidity. - **Cost Advantage**: It provides some of the lowest baseline transaction fee structures in the market, starting at roughly 1.95%. - **Razorpay**: Known as the most reliable fintech powerhouse in India, it is highly recommended for marketplaces that require deep API customizations. - **Marketplace Capabilities**: Through **Razorpay Route**, the platform handles complex money routing, automated marketplace commissions, and physical seller onboarding effortlessly. - **Integration**: Offers exceptional developer documentation and plug-and-play modules for common marketplace builders. - **Success Rates**: Its intelligent routing infrastructure delivers the industry's highest transaction success rates for domestic and card networks. - **PayU India**: A robust, enterprise-grade aggregator preferred by heavy-volume consumer marketplaces. - **Marketplace Capabilities**: PayU handles large-scale operations with advanced multi-party payment settlement systems and rigid fraud controls. - **Payment Variety**: It features native support for over 150+ local and international payment rails, including complex EMIs and Buy Now Pay Later (BNPL) schemes. Key Requirements for Indian Marketplaces in 2026 When choosing your gateway, ensure they provide these three vital elements: 1. **Automated Split Payouts**: The system must isolate your platform commission fee from the seller's revenue instantly at checkout to avoid complex accounting messy manual transfers. 2. **RBI Nodal Compliance**: Under RBI rules, marketplaces cannot hold customer money in standard corporate bank accounts. Ensure your gateway uses official node/escrow accounts to stay legally compliant. 3. **Frictionless UPI Processing**: With UPI capturing up to 85% of online consumer transactions in India, a seamless, deep-linked UPI checkout flow is mandatory to minimize cart abandonment.
